#08e58c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08e58c is composed of 3.1% red, 89.8%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#08e58c color hex could be obtained by blending #10ffff with #00cb19.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#08e58c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08e58c has RGB values of R:8, G:229,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 583052.

Shades and Tints of #08e58c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#08e58c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757877 is the less saturated color, while #08e58c is the most saturated one.
